Health Tip: Know the Dangers of Mold
By LadyLively on July 24, 2015

Mold growing inside your home can cause serious, even deadly, allergic reactions.
The U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ention says potential symptoms of mold allergy include:
- A stuffy nose.
- Irritated eyes.
- Wheezing, coughing or throat irritation.
- Rash or other skin allergy.
- Serious lung infections among people with a compromised immune system or chronic lung disease.
